    Slow image restore from one partition to another on the same drive.


    Three cases here:

    Case 1:
    Samsung entry level AMD laptop bought in 2011. Image backup of partition C (30GB) to partition D on the same physical drive is quick, takes 10 min. Restore is quick too, takes about 25 min.

    Case 2:
    Asus mid-range i3 laptop bought in 2012. Image backup of C (30GB) to D on the same physical drive is quick. However, restore takes 3 hours!
    My solution is to copy the image folder to an external HDD and restore partition C from that external HDD instead (with USB3.0 drivers loaded during restoring). it takes 8 min to complete restore.

    Case 3:
    Fujitse mid-range i3 latpop bought last month. It's the same case as Case 2.

    My question: Do I need to load special drivers for restoring image from one partition to another on the same physical HDD?

    Probably a controller difference between the different PC's. You found a solution - use a different drive.
    It's not a good idea to keep the image on the same physical drive anyway.
    Never heard of using different HD drivers.
